In this short and sweet Do Life Big Podcast episode, we’re diving into how we can start to think more clearly and get to the truth of what's really happening, rather than living in a distorted reality full of made-up stories that keep us trapped and feeling like victims. 🚫🧠
Have you ever found yourself interpreting something someone said in a way that made you feel awful, only to later realize that wasn’t what they meant at all? 🤔 I definitely have!
Let me tell you a story from when I was a new teacher.
I remember teaching a lesson and getting observed by my principal. Afterward, he gave me constructive criticism, but in my mind, I twisted it into thinking he believed I was a terrible teacher. That wasn’t the truth at all—it was just a story I made up. 😬📚
We do this all the time. We create these narratives that aren’t based on facts, and they keep us from living our truth and finding freedom. It’s like being inside a jar and not being able to read the label. 🏷️
We need to pull ourselves out, look objectively, and ask, "What’s really happening here?" 🌟
